General Purpose: Performs a variety of skilled and unskilled tasks in the custodian care and maintenance of city buildings, parks and playgrounds.
Supervision Received: Works under the supervision of either the Building Maintenance Supervisor and/or Park Operations Supervisor and/or Coordinator or Crew Leader.
Supervision Exercised: None generally. May supervise temporary employees or community service workers.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ities:
(A) Working knowledge of equipment, materials and supplies used in building and grounds maintenance; working knowledge of equipment and supplies used to do minor repairs; some knowledge of first aid and applicable safety precautions; (B) Skill in operation of listed tools and equipment. (C) Ability to work independently and to complete daily activities according to work schedule; ability to lift heavy objects, walk and stand for long periods of time; ability to communicate orally and in writing; ability to use equipment and tools properly and safely; ability to understand and follow written and oral instructions; ability to establish effective working relationships; ability to perform a heavy manual task for extended periods of time.
Floor buffers, steam cleaners, carpet cleaners, washers, vacuum, mops, broom, dusting equipment, weed-eater, edger, various power tools dealing with park maintenance.
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ential duties.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to reach with hands and arms. The employee is frequently required to stand; walk; and use hands to handle, feel or operate objects, tools or controls. The employee is occasionally required to sit; climb or balance; st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l and talk or hear. The employee must frequently lift and/or move up to 25 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move more than 100 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, and the ability to adjust focus.
The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. While performing the duties of this job, the employee occasionally works near moving mechanical parts. The employee occasionally works in high, precarious places and is exposed to wet and or humid conditions, outdoor weather conditions, fumes or airborne particles and toxic chemicals. The employee is occasionally exposed to risk of electrical shock. The noise level in the work environment is from quiet during indoor night shift operations to loud while operating power equipment.
